Is a woven cotton label made of 100% cotton yarn
No, typically, woven cotton labels are not made of 100% pure cotton. Due to mechanical and process limitations, a complete woven cotton label generally contains only about 60% cotton yarn.
A full woven label is usually made using three different types of yarn. If all the yarns were 100% pure cotton, the machinery would not function properly.
Additionally, it is not recommended to use a heat-cut (straight-cut) folding method for cotton labels, as cotton yarn lacks thermoplastic properties and may wear out after washing. We recommend using end-fold or center-fold methods instead.
